Our civilization’s previous economy was built upon warehouses of fixed goods and factories stockpiled with solid cargo. These physical stocks are still necessary, but they are no longer sufficient for wealth and happiness. Our attention has moved away from stocks of solid goods to flows of intangibles, like copies. We value not only the atoms in a thing, but their immaterial arrangement and design and, even more, their ability to adapt and flow in response to our needs.
The Inevitable: Understanding the 12 Technological Forces That Will Shape Our Future
